1. Cardstock: The foundation of any card-making project, cardstock comes in a variety of colors, weights, and finishes. Look for high-quality cardstock that is sturdy enough to hold embellishments and withstand the mailing process.

2. Adhesives: A good adhesive is essential for assembling your cards. Double-sided tape, glue dots, and liquid glue are all popular choices among card makers. Make sure to choose an adhesive that is strong enough to hold your embellishments in place.

3. Stamps: Stamps are a versatile tool that can add unique designs and sentiments to your cards. Look for a variety of stamps in different themes to suit any occasion.

4. Ink pads: Quality ink pads are a must-have for stamping your designs onto cardstock. Choose pigment or dye-based inks in a range of colors to add dimension and interest to your cards.

5. Embellishments: Add a touch of sparkle and dimension to your cards with embellishments such as rhinestones, sequins, ribbons, and buttons. These little extras can take your card from ordinary to extraordinary.

6. Die cutting machine: If you want to take your card-making to the next level, invest in a die cutting machine. This machine allows you to create intricate designs and shapes with ease, helping you to achieve professional-looking results.

7. Scissors and paper trimmer: Precision cutting is essential in card making. Invest in a good pair of scissors and a paper trimmer to ensure clean, straight edges on your cards.

8. Heat embossing tool: Heat embossing adds a glossy, raised finish to your stamped designs. A heat embossing tool is a must-have for this technique, as it melts embossing powder onto your cardstock for a beautiful effect.

9. Coloring tools: If you enjoy coloring your stamped images, consider investing in markers, colored pencils, or watercolor paints. These tools allow you to add depth and detail to your designs.

10. Storage solutions: Keep your craft supplies organized and easily accessible with storage solutions such as bins, boxes, and caddies. This will help you stay organized and make crafting more efficient.

Q: What are some beginner-friendly supplies for card making?
A: If you’re new to card making, start with essential supplies like cardstock, adhesive, stamps, and ink pads. As you gain confidence and skill, you can expand your collection with more advanced tools and embellishments.
